The microscope has different coarse (B) and fine (A) focus mechanisms. Fine focus knob (A) rotates the central fine-pitch screw. This, in turn, moves the entire coarse focus assembly (B) along the triangular support pillars.
Coarse focus is rack & pinion. Turning the knob slides the center support bar (A) up or down. It, in turn, is supported by the lateral, triangular support pillars.
